如何利用MATLAB建立三相异步电动机的数学模型,并进行直接转矩控制仿真分析?
时间: 2024-11-04 12:19:39 浏览: 30
在探索三相异步电动机的仿真过程中,MATLAB提供了一个强大的平台来实现复杂的数学模型和控制系统设计。要建立三相异步电动机的数学模型并进行直接转矩控制(DTC)仿真分析,首先需要了解电动机的基本工作原理和相关的数学方程,包括电压方程、磁链方程和转矩方程。这些方程为电动机的电磁行为提供了数学描述。
参考资源链接:[MATLAB模拟三相异步电机:动态模型与仿真分析](https://wenku.csdn.net/doc/5gck3zwaan?spm=1055.2569.3001.10343)
在MATLAB中,可以使用Simulink工具来搭建电动机的仿真模型。首先,根据电动机的物理参数(如电阻、电感、磁链等)以及上述数学方程,构建定子和转子的电压方程。接着,利用坐标变换(如Clarke和Park变换)将三相交流量转换为两相直流量,简化模型并便于实现DTC策略。
在仿真中,直接转矩控制策略是通过选择合适的电压矢量来直接控制电动机的转矩和磁链。这需要实现一个调制器,根据转矩和磁链的误差来决定下一个最佳电压矢量,以达到快速响应和精确控制的目的。
通过MATLAB仿真,可以模拟电动机在不同负载和操作条件下的性能,观察转速、电流波形和转矩等关键参数的变化,并对系统的动态特性进行分析。这不仅有助于理解电动机的工作原理,还能对电机控制器的设计进行验证和优化。
综上所述,通过掌握电动机的数学模型和MATLAB/Simulink的仿真能力,可以有效地进行三相异步电动机的直接转矩控制仿真分析。《MATLAB模拟三相异步电机:动态模型与仿真分析》将为你提供一个详细的指导,帮助你从理论到实践全面掌握这一过程。
参考资源链接:[MATLAB模拟三相异步电机:动态模型与仿真分析](https://wenku.csdn.net/doc/5gck3zwaan?spm=1055.2569.3001.10343)
阅读全文